Output f926723f81f1d6806f4c3130f3bd24e7b79faa686d3154f4777e1dcfe014f18f:5

value
28850300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f775785e59cdb5ab39d296c84d7635ee133749 OP_EQUAL
address
3EuXfunY3y2vp8CNtAEimazfec6ZmFZzMV
transaction
f926723f81f1d6806f4c3130f3bd24e7b79faa686d3154f4777e1dcfe014f18f
confirmations
123196
spent
true